The Role of a Car Locksmith
A car locksmith concentrates on offering security options for lorries, consisting of key replacement, lock setup, and emergency situation lockout assistance. Unlike a basic locksmith who works with a variety of locks, an automotive locksmith focuses entirely on the elaborate mechanisms discovered in vehicles, trucks, and other cars. These professionals are geared up with the current tools and technology to manage a vast array of automotive security requirements.
Common Services Offered by Car Locksmiths
Key Replacement and Duplication
- Lost or Stolen Keys: If you've lost your keys or they have been stolen, a car locksmith can provide a brand-new set. They use specific equipment to develop exact duplicates of your original keys.
- Broken Keys: Sometimes, keys break inside the lock, making it difficult to eliminate them. A professional locksmith can extract the broken key car locksmith and create a new one.
Keyless Entry and Ignition Systems
- Programing Key Fobs: Modern cars often come with keyless entry systems. A car locksmith can program and replace key fobs, making sure that your vehicle's electronic components work flawlessly.
- Ignition Interlock Devices: For motorists with a history of DUI, ignition interlock gadgets are in some cases mandated by law. A car locksmith can install and maintain these devices.
Lock Installation and Repair
- New Locks: If your vehicle's locks are damaged or malfunctioning, a car locksmith can install brand-new ones.
- Lock Repair: Rather than replacing locks, a locksmith can often repair them, saving you money and time.
Emergency Situation Lockout Assistance
- 24/7 Service: Being locked out of your car can happen at any time. Many car locksmiths use 24/7 emergency services to help you get back on the road quickly.
- Expert Tools: They use specialized tools to open your vehicle without causing damage, which is particularly crucial for newer models with intricate security systems.
High-Security Locks and Keys
- Transponder Keys: These keys include a chip that interacts with the car's computer system. A car locksmith can program and replace these keys.
- Laser-Cut Keys: Some high-end vehicles use laser-cut keys for improved security. An expert locksmith can develop these keys utilizing exact laser-cutting technology.

FAQs
Q: How do I know if a car locksmith is legitimate?
- A: A legitimate car locksmith will be accredited, bonded, and guaranteed. They need to also be able to offer evidence of ownership before carrying out any services. Furthermore, check for positive evaluations and a good track record in the community.
Q: Can a car locksmiths near me locksmith make a key for a vehicle without the original?
- A: Yes, a professional car locksmith can develop a new key even if you do not have the original. However, they will require the vehicle's make, model, and often the VIN to guarantee the key is right.
Q: How long does it take to replace a car key?
- A: The time it takes to replace a car key can vary depending on the intricacy of the lock and the type of key. Easy key duplications can take simply a couple of minutes, while more complicated jobs like programming transponder keys may take an hour or more.
Q: Will a car locksmith damage my vehicle when unlocking it?
- A: A professional car locksmith will use non-invasive strategies to open your vehicle, minimizing the danger of damage. Nevertheless, if a key is stuck in the lock, some minor damage might be unavoidable.
Q: Can a car locksmith near me car bypass the ignition system?
- A: While a certified car locksmith can bypass the ignition system to unlock your car, they will not do so unless you can show ownership of the vehicle. Bypassing the ignition system without proper authorization is unlawful.
